Skip to content

Conversation

@bgentry
Copy link
Contributor

@bgentry bgentry commented Apr 9, 2025

Added a queue detail page with the ability to view queue stats. For River Pro customers, this page offers the ability to dynamically override concurrency limits and to view individual clients for each queue, along with how many jobs each is working.

I'm sure there will be lots of additional tweaks to make to this in the future but it's a solid start IMO.

@brandur I've organized the commits to hopefully make this easier for you to look at. Everything is small and granular with the exception of the giant JS commit 😆

Screenshot 2025-04-08 at 9 52 55 PM

bgentry added 3 commits April 7, 2025 16:49
Don't use Goose migration files, use plain SQL schema files for sqlc.
@bgentry bgentry requested a review from brandur April 9, 2025 02:54
@bgentry bgentry force-pushed the bg-concurrency branch 3 times, most recently from dd8e1ae to f48340a Compare April 9, 2025 03:10
This was referenced Apr 9, 2025
Copy link
Collaborator

@brandur brandur left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Great stuff Blake! Some of the TS is a little beyond me, but seems to be generally good. Let's bias towards getting this out the door.

@bgentry bgentry merged commit 6e36094 into master Apr 9, 2025
13 checks passed
@bgentry bgentry deleted the bg-concurrency branch April 9, 2025 12:37
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ants